What is a polymer composite material?
Polymer matrix composites are composite materials composed of a variety of short fibers or continuous fibers bonded together by an organic polymer matrix. PMCs are designed to transfer loads between the fibers of the matrix.

What are some examples of polymer composites?
example is Graphite/epoxy, Kevlar/epoxy and boron/epoxy composites. Advanced composite materials are traditionally used in the aerospace industry, but these materials are now also used in the commercial industry.

What is the difference between polymers and composites?
However, according to the existing literature, the main difference between polymer blends and composites is that A polymer blend is a single-phase mixture of two or more polymerswhile composite materials are composed of two or more elements combined to form a multiphase, multicomponent system, where…

What are the 3 Different Types of Fiber Reinforced Composites?
Fiber-reinforced composite materials can be divided into four categories according to their matrix: Metal Matrix Composites (MMC), Ceramic Matrix Composites (CMC), Carbon/Carbon Composites (C/C)and polymer matrix composites (PMCs) or polymer composites (Figure 3.10).

Is epoxy resin a polymer?
Epoxy is a polymer Also known as polyepoxides, each monomer contains at least two and more epoxy groups, also known as glycidyl or ethylene oxide groups.
Is nylon a polymer or a composite?
Nylon is a generic name for a family synthetic polymer Consists of polyamides (repeating units linked by amide bonds). Nylon is a silk-like thermoplastic, usually made from petroleum, that can be melt processed into fibers, films or shapes.
What are the 4 polymers?
terms. Synthetic polymers are man-made polymers. From a utility standpoint, they can be grouped into four broad categories: Thermoplastics, Thermosets, Elastomers and Synthetic Fibers.

What are the three main types of polymers?
Polymers are mainly divided into 3 categories – Thermoplastics, Thermosets and Elastomers. The distinction between these categories is best defined by their behavior under applied heat. Thermoplastic polymers can be amorphous or crystalline. They behave in a relatively malleable manner, but are generally less strong.
